Here I will use cri-o which is a compliant runtime. You can still use docker, then install using sudo apt-get install docker.io We should use OCI compliant container runtime to pull and run OCI images, especially if you use Kubernetes services like GKE, EKS, or AKS. Docker produces images that are not an OCI (Open Container Initiative) image. From the release of Kubernetes 1.20, the container runtime interface (CRI) shim for Docker is being deprecated. The most commonly used runtime is Docker.
